AppSense Specialist Course v8.1

Overview
This two-day instructor-led course provides the necessary techniques to install, perform advanced configuration and monitor user virtualization solutions using the AppSense Environment Manager product in enterprise environments. Formal instructor-led training quickly gets the delegate familiar with the two components of AppSense Environment Manager, policy and personalization. This course prepares administrators to perform AppSense Environment Manager installations and advanced administrative tasks. This is the AppSense Specialist curriculum and contains some subject matter for the AppSense Specialist exam, (APP-201).

Prerequisites
- Understanding of user profiles (v1 and v2)
- Understanding of networking
- Understanding of Windows operating systems
- Understanding of the registry
- Understanding of security best practices. For example, file system permissions, authentication methods, Kerberos etc
- Hands-on experience with: IIS, SQL, Windows Registry settings
- Attendance of 3 day AppSense Professional level course
